2. Mark Your Property Boundaries

When snow accumulates, it can obscure the boundaries of your property. This can make it difficult for snow removal crews to know exactly where to clear. Before the snow falls, place markers along driveways, sidewalks, and curbs to define your property’s boundaries. This simple step helps snow removal professionals work quickly and accurately.

3. Check Your Walkways and Driveways

Before winter hits, ensure that your walkways and driveways are in good condition. Cracks or damage to surfaces can worsen in cold weather and become even more difficult to fix once the snow is gone. If you have uneven surfaces, consider repairing them before the season begins to avoid injury and ensure that snow can be removed effectively. 4. Plan for Snow Storage

Where will all the snow go? Snow piles can accumulate quickly, taking up valuable space on your property. Before winter begins, plan for snow storage areas. 5. Maintain Your Snow Removal Equipment (If DIY)

If you choose to tackle snow removal yourself, ensure your snow removal equipment is in top working condition. Check your snow blower, shovels, and salt spreaders to ensure they are ready for use. Having backup equipment like a snow shovel on hand can help in case your primary tools malfunction.
